Lightmap's HDR Light Studio brings lighting simplicity to CINEMA 4D
London, UK (PRWEB UK) 18 March 2014 -- Lightmap announces a new HDR Light Studio Live plug-in for Maxon CINEMA 4D bringing simplicity to HDRI lighting. The new plug-in works with all versions of CINEMA 4D R13 and higher and supports additional market leading renderers, V-Ray, Maxwell and Octane Render.
HDR Light Studio lets artists easily create and edit HDRI lighting in real-time. With the CINEMA 4D Live Connection artists quickly develop the custom HDRI map in HDR Light Studio and see its lighting effect evolve in the Interactive Render. Use the LightPaint feature to click on the 3D model in the CINEMA 4D viewport to position the lighting effects. This ‘click to light’ process will dramatically speed up the lighting process with precise and perfect final results.

Main HDR Light Studio features for CINEMA 4D users:
• Non-destructive, interactive HDRI map creation and editing app
• Live Connection between HDR Light Studio and CINEMA 4D
• Supports CINEMA 4D Renderer, V-Ray, Maxwell and Octane Render
• LightPaint – Point and click light source positioning and selection in CINEMA 4D
• Push scenes into HDR Light Studio's 3D view for a fast LightPaint experience on large scenes
• Highly controllable procedural light sources
• Library of HDR lights, including HDR captures of studio light sources
• Layered lighting system with blend modes
• Enhance existing HDRI maps via localised adjustments to color, exposure, and saturation
• Augment existing HDRI maps with additional light sources
• HDR Light Studio lighting project embedded in the CINEMA 4D scene

About HDR Light Studio
Launched in 2009, HDR Light Studio has become the de facto standard for interactive creation and control of image based lighting for computer graphics. The software provides a fast and efficient way to light a 3D scene with photo-real results, while fitting into all major 3D rendering pipelines on the market. It is used worldwide by 3D artists lighting CGI shots of cars, jewelry and all other rendered models and in animated TV commercials and movie VFX.
